What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time service worker?

To thrive as a Part Time Service Worker, you generally need strong customer service skills, reliability, and a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with point-of-sale (POS) systems, basic cash handling, and sometimes food safety certifications are often required. Excellent communication, teamwork, and a positive attitude help individuals stand out in this position. These skills ensure efficient service delivery, satisfied customers, and a supportive work environment in fast-paced settings.

What are the typical work schedules and flexibility options for part time service roles?

Part-time service roles often offer a range of scheduling options, including evenings, weekends, and split shifts, making them ideal for students or those seeking supplemental income. Employers typically post weekly or bi-weekly schedules, but many also accommodate availability changes with advance notice. While flexibility is a common benefit, shifts can vary week to week based on business needs, so reliable communication with your supervisor is important. Being open to working peak hours or holidays may also increase your chances for more shifts and advancement opportunities.

What is a part time service job?

Part time service jobs are positions in the service industry that require employees to work fewer hours than a standard full-time schedule, typically less than 35-40 hours per week. These jobs can include roles in retail, food service, hospitality, customer support, and more. Part time service jobs often offer flexible scheduling, making them ideal for students, parents, or individuals seeking supplemental income. While benefits may vary, these roles often provide valuable customer service experience and the opportunity to develop important workplace skills.

JOB RESPONSIBILITIES:
Bring up enough carts for the days use.
Clean picking the range on a schedule once a week, making sure that you get every ball on range and those under fences, in all landscape shrubs, and outside of fences. Pick-up and replace ropes and markers on driving range tee box on days after mowing.
Keep enough range balls in range machine or golf shop.
Keep the range tee box set up properly with baskets picked up as needed along with bag stands and all chairs returned to proper place.
Rotate the ropes and tee markers on an as needed basis.
Keep the target flags in proper positions on the range.
Clean out and keep fresh water in coolers on course and range. Twice daily during spring and summer months.
Pick up all trash off course, around clubhouse and in the park.
Put down carts as they come in off the course and make sure they are washed properly and charged for the next day.
Keep clean soapy water and good towels on ball washers.
Make sure all walks, cart paths, and street around clubhouse, #1 tee, and driving range tee box are blown off and clean of all litter.
Other duties as assigned for the proper operation of Eagle Ridge Golf Course.
